Inspectors have visited El Faro Caribbean Seafood three times, with records going back to 2017. El Faro Caribbean Seafood was last inspected on Nov 28, 2017. A low risk rating suggests inspectors haven't found much to be concerned about lately. The file hasn't been updated since Nov 28, 2017, so take the current picture with that in mind.

The picture has improved over the last few visits: recent inspections have averaged around zero violations, down from roughly two violations earlier in the record.

Among Chicago restaurants, the typical score is 81; El Faro Caribbean Seafood is comfortably above that bar. Overall, the inspection record reads well.

Aug 18, 2017
License
4 minor violations.
View 4 violations
Adequate number, convenient, accessible, designed, and maintained
Inspector notes: INADEQUATE HAND WASHING FACILITIES ON PREMISES: NO EXPOSED HAND SINK IN THE MAIN PREP/KITCHEN AREA. INSTRUCTED TO INSTALL AN ADDITIONAL EXPOSED HAND SINK IN THE KITCHEN WITH SOAP, PAPER TOWELS, HOT/COLD RUNNING WATER UNDER CITY PRESSURE. CRITICAL VIOLATION 7-38-030
11
Food protected during storage, preparation, display, service and transportation
Inspector notes: KITCHEN PREP AREA NOT PROTECTED FROM THE PUBLIC: MUST PROVIDE A BARRIER, DOOR, SWINGING DOOR ETC. TO PROTECT THE MAIN KITCHEN PREP AREA FROM CUSTOMERS WALKING TO THE BATHROOM. SERIOUS VIOLATION 7-38-005A
16
Floors: constructed per code, cleaned, good repair, coving installed, dust-less cleaning methods used
Inspector notes: OBSERVED ASTRO-TURF COVERING THE FLOOR IN THE UTILITY CLOSET WHERE DRY STORAGE RACKS ARE LOCATED USED TO STORE CLEAN POTS AND PANS ETC. MUST REMOVE ASTRO-TURF TO PROVIDE A FLOOR THAT IS SMOOTH, EASILY CLEANABLE TO ALLOW ROUTINE CLEANING.
34
Walls, ceilings, attached equipment constructed per code: good repair, surfaces clean and dust-less cleaning methods
Inspector notes: OBSERVED AN OPEN CEILING WITH VARIOUS WOOD BEAMS ABOVE THE MAIN KITCHEN PREP AREA. MUST PROVIDE A FLAT, SMOOTH EASILY CLEANABLE SURFACE FOR THE CEILING ABOVE THE KITCHEN PREP AREA TO ALLOW ROUTINE CLEANING.
